Living History Day

Living History Day

Living History Day will celebrate two important dates for the Mighty Mo – the 80th anniversary of the USS Missouri’s launch into service and the 25th anniversary of the public opening as an historic attraction in Pearl Harbor. Displays and exhibits from other historic sites, organizations and active military commands will add to the celebration and education. The public will learn about the important work that our organizations do to preserve history and share our special stories.
